rotundness
Rotundness refers to the state or quality of being round, plump, or full-bodied in shape, often associated with a spherical or bulbous form. The term is commonly used in various contexts, including anatomy, aesthetics, and descriptive language, to convey a sense of fullness or roundedness. In human anatomy, rotundness may describe a body type characterized by a proportionally large abdomen, often linked to higher body fat percentages. This physical trait can be influenced by genetic factors, dietary habits, and metabolic processes.
